By Ha Thu  October 17, 2018 | 05:56 pm GMT+7 About 8,000 tickets to singer My Tam’s concert in Seoul were sold out online in 10 days. On October 20, popular Vietnamese singer My Tam will perform in her first live concert in South Korea at the Jangchung stadium in Seoul. It promises to be a sellout event with all tickets near the stage sold out and only a few slots left for those at a distance, event organizers said. The website selling the tickets crashed a few days ago in the rush of people trying to buy tickets. My Tam had previously planned the live show for September 15, but said she was deferring it to give more time for fans in Vietnam to get visas to South Korea. A few Korean enterprises have bought the tickets as gifts for their Vietnamese employees. The team that organized this event is from South Korea. It includes My Tam’s long time collaborator Cho Song Jin as an editor and co-director with the singer. Better, universal payment system needed for public transit: experts
Viet Nam News HCM CITY — A contactless payment system for public transport in HCM City could save costs and increase customer satisfaction, experts said at a conference on modern payments systems for public transit on Friday. Lê Hoàn of the HCM City Management Centre of Public Transport said that buses satisfied only 4.7 per cent of the city’s travel needs, and that most passengers still used printed tickets. The city has been developing a smart card system which allows passengers to use cards issued by bus companies that are topped up with money to purchase digital tickets, without using cash. However, he said the city should focus on linking different ticketing systems together into a more universal one. Universal Studios Japan™
1. Spacious, diverse entertainment options Universal Studios Japan has been open to tourists since March 2001, making it the first theme park under the Universal Studios brand built in Asia. Among other things, it has been hailed as a top destination for free individual travelers, or FIT, referring to people who prefer to travel alone and make their own travel plans. Lying in the heart of the Osaka Bay Area with a total area of 39 hectares, Universal Studios Japan is one of the most famous and most-visited parks in Japan. A replica of the “Hogwarts Express” in Harry Potter theme park. Photo courtesy of Warner Bros. Entertainment Inc. Harry Potter Publishing Rights JKR.(s18) Currently, the park can be broadly characterized under eight different themes: Hollywood, New York, San Francisco, Jurassic Park, Waterworld, Amity Village, Universal Wonderland and The Wizarding World of Harry Potter. Railway ticket prices for long trips cut 20-50%
Viet Nam News HCM CITY — Passengers buying train tickets 20 days in advance of their journey will have the price reduced, ranging from 20 per cent to 50 per cent, the Sài Gòn Railway Transport JSC has announced. The promotion applies to trips of more than 1,000km on the Thống Nhất (North - South) route and TPHCM–Huế route at Sài Gòn Train Station. Passengers booking train tickets 20 days before the departure date will enjoy a cut of 20 per cent to 30 per cent, on routes from HCM City to the central provinces of Quy Nhơn, Nha Trang and Quãng Ngãi. Price reductions will not apply for passengers on air-conditioned four sleeper-seat cabins. Tickets can be returned or exchanged 72 hours prior to the departure date. In case of exchange, passengers have to pay 20-50 per cent of its value, depending on the route. Groups of over 10 passengers will see their ticket prices cut by 3-12 per cent. Vietnam’s first university goes multilingual to cater for foreign visitors
Hanoi's renowned Temple of Literature is trying to connect with foreign visitors by offering audio guides in eight different languages. Those fluent in French, Spanish, Korean, Japanese, Thai, English, Chinese, and of course, Vietnamese, should now be able to explore the temple, Vietnam's first university built in 1070, with confidence. With a ticket costing VND30,000 ($1.32), visitors are equipped with headphones and players for tours around the temple. Hanoi received almost 4.95 million foreign visitors in 2017, up 23 percent from the previous year. Hanoi is an affordable city, a great place for people to immerse themselves in, and a great place for food, said Australian travel writer Phoebe Lee, who visited Hanoi to star in two commercials aired by U.S. television network CNN as part of a $2 million tourism deal inked with the city last year. Poor students gifted bus tickets to return home for Tet
The Ho Chi Minh City Student Assistance Centre (SAC) will present 3,000 bus tickets to disadvantaged students to help them return home for Tet. (Source: VNA) HCMCity (VNA) – The Ho Chi Minh City Student Assistance Centre (SAC) willpresent 3,000 bus tickets to disadvantaged students to help them return homefor Tet (Lunar New Year). The buses will depart from HCM City to central provinces, especially those hithard by the recent floods and storms, said SAC Deputy Director Le Xuan Dung onJanuary 5. On this occasion, the centre will provide 5,000 jobs for needy university studentsduring the holiday, mostly cashier, packaging worker, supermarket staff,security guard, shipper and switchboard operator. Besides, it will present gifts to underprivileged children in orphanages andthe city’s outlying areas.
